SMS Karlsruhe
Type: Light Cruiser Konigsberg II class. She was built at Wilhelmshaven by Laiserliches Werft in 1916 and was 497ft long with a beam of 47ft and a draught of 21ft.The Karlsruhe was powered by two coal/oil fired turbines that could take her to speeds up to 28 knots. She was armed with twelve 4.1" guns, two 19.7" torpedo tubes and was scuttled by her crew on 21 June 1919 at 1645 hrs together with the entire German High Seas Fleet .
Wreck Information : The Karlsruhe is the shallowest of the German high seas fleet, she lies on her starboard side with capstans and anchor chain on the bows, and there are two 6 inch guns which have fallen onto the seabed from the deck. The mid section has been salvaged and has opened up the inside of the wreck. The stern is intact and makes a good picture from the seabed if the viz is good.

Distance from harbour: 5.5 Nm
Lat / Long: 58 53 23N, 003 11 18W West side of Cava.
Chart: Admiralty Chart 35, Scapa Flow and Approaches.
Depth: 26m on the seabed and 12m at the shallowest point. Great for Nitrox
